“方法1:使用GROUP BY SQL Query SELECT COUNT(*) FROM `prince` GROUP BY `mother` > 24; 执行结果 count(*) 50029 49971 在100,000行数据上的运行时间:0.0335 秒 分析 这种GROUP BY方法的最大问题在于:无法区分所得到的结果。这两个数字哪一个是天宫娘娘们所生的皇子数,哪一个是地宫娘娘们所生的皇子数呢?不知道。所以,尽管它统计...
在mysql中,可以使用SELECT语句查询数据,并利用COUNT()函数统计查询结果的数量,语法“SELECT COUNT(*) FROM 表名 [...];”或“SELECT COUNT(字段名) FROM 表名...
Mysql的计数实现 在不同的mysql引擎中,count(*)的执行逻辑是不一样的: MyISAM引擎把一个表的总行数存在了磁盘上,因此执行count(*)的时候会直接返回这个数,效率很高; InnoDB引擎执行c...
,计数()与选择()中的在语义上是不同的,选择()因为不使用覆盖索引,所以不推荐使用,MySQL查询分析器对于COUNT(*)优化在5.6版本以后 COUNT(*)与计数(COL)与计数(VAL): 在没有哪条件的...
python查询数据库字段为decimal类型的数据结果为科学计数法的问题 一、使用Python连接数据库 import pymysql import readConfig class ReadMysql(): def GetConnect(self): self.co...
MySQL之count计数 在开发系统的时候,你可能经常需要计算一个表的行数,比如一个交易系统的所有变更记录...首先要明确的是,在不同的 MySQL 引擎中,count(*) 有...
这篇文章主要介绍了两种方法实现mysql分组计数,范围汇总,文中示例代码非常详细,帮助大家更好的理解和学习,感兴趣的朋友可以了解下第一种:常规操作 SELECT SUM(d...
计数一行: 代码层面,将会在 evaluate_join_record 函数中对所读取的行进行评估,看其是否应当计入 count 中 ( 即是否要 count++ )。 简单来说,COUNT(arg) 本身...
收录于:2023-01-31 17:50:29